hooks: print out more information when loading a python hook fails When loading a python hook with file syntax fails, there is no information that this happened while loading a hook. When the python file does not exist even the file name is not printed. (Only that a file is missing.) This patch adds this information and a test for loading a non existing file and a directory not being a python module.
